The bathroom has progressed a considerably over the past hundred years. It was once a simple tub located in front of the fireplace in the living room with water buckets, the bathing experience is now an added luxury in nearly every western house. In the past, bathing in a "bathroom" was a luxury only the wealthy and privileged could afford to install in their homes. This was the trend that led to the mass production in bathroom accessories. This is why the Edwardian and Victorian designs of the time remain a favorite for bathrooms today. They look fantastic in a cottage or villa bathroom, and never loose the appeal of style.
